2. Butyric acid is a fatty acid occurring in the form of esters in animal fats. Molecular formula of butyric acid is C4H&O2. Show your work (a) Calculate the molar mass of butyric acid, C4H&O2. (b) How many moles of C4H&O2 are in 6.00 g of butyric acid? (c) How many atoms of oxygen is present in 6.00 g of butyric acid, C4HeO2?
